Легенда:
новое сообщение
закрытая нитка
новое сообщение
в закрытой нитке
старое сообщение
|
- Напоминаю, что масса вопросов по функционированию форума снимается после прочтения его описания.
- Новичкам также крайне полезно ознакомиться с данным документом.
Ну, вот, знакомтесь - это grub =). 17.01.06 13:40 Число просмотров: 3187
Автор: fly4life <Александр Кузнецов> Статус: Elderman
|
> > А оно нулями было забито, скорее всего, из-за того, > что > > нету кода загрузчика в первом секторе раздела, на > котором > > установлен Ubuntu (/dev/hda2, да?). Признавайся, до > > переустановки ты винду грузил grub'ом? ;) > Я даже не знаю grub это или не grub -- это то, что Ubuntu > поставило при установке с инсталл CD. При этом оно > корректно оставило возможность грузить XP. А после > переустановки XP не могу загрузить Ubuntu. > Надо что-то делать...
Ну, вот, знакомтесь - это grub =).
1) Можно сделать "как было до переустановки винды" - т.е. винду грузить из grub'а.
Если при загрузке с Uduntu install CD выбрать режим 'rescue' (слово вводится в строке приглашения 'boot:'), то на этапе загрузки тебя спросят, на каком разделе находится корень твоей linux-системы. Выбирай /dev/hda2 и после того, как попадёшь в командную строку, набери:
# grub-install /dev/hda
(надеюсь, расположение винды и таблица разделов у тебя не поменялись ;))
Если не спросят (ну хоть убей, не помню я, как это в Ubuntu происходит), то после загрузки в командную строку набирай последовательно:
# mount -t ext3 /dev/hda2 /mnt
# chroot /mnt
# grub-install /dev/hda
Первая команда смонтирует твой корень в директорию /mnt. Вторая - сделает /mnt новым корнем системы, третья - запишет код загрузчика в MBR.
2) Можно сделать так, чтобы загрузка линукса шла из ntloader. Для этого нужно проделать всё тоже, что описано выше, только код загрузчика устанавливать не в MBR, а в бут-сектор раздела с linux (в твоём случае: /dev/hda2):
# grub-install /dev/hda2
Ну, а затем всё, как ты уже делал:
# dd if=/dev/hda2 of=/mnt/floppy/bootsect.lnx bs=512 count=1
И, соответственно, настроить boot.ini.
Всё.
|
|
|